    Both are old and terrible fakes. Here is some free advice;

    1: don't start your helmet collection career / hobby with SS helmets. Begin with a nice no decal M42 in all original condition and work your way up from there
    2: Insist on good photos always and with good head on clear and in focus no glare photos of the decals, anything less tell the seller to pound salt
    3: buy some good reference books, many links abound on this forum and you really need no more than 3 that cover all the bases
    4: don't fall for the dealer lifetime guarantee or the nobody can say what's real anymore shtick. Neither are guarantees of originality
    5: anyone sending you a camera angle like the 3 helmets you've posted is trying to get into your wallet big time. Tell them your willing to pay in monopoly money.
    6: post anything your interested in buying first but learn to spot the charlatans and don't waste your time with them.
